Chimney Sweeping in Los Angeles County, CA
Chimney sweeping services involve the thorough cleaning of a chimney’s interior to remove built-up soot, creosote, and debris that can accumulate over time. This process is essential for maintaining proper airflow and reducing the risk of chimney fires. Projects typically include cleaning fireplaces, wood stoves, and other venting systems to ensure they operate efficiently and safely. Homeowners often request chimney sweeping before the colder months or after heavy use, and they should understand the importance of regular inspections and cleanings to prevent blockages and potential hazards.
Property owners should consider the type of chimney and venting system they have, as well as any signs of damage or creosote buildup, when requesting chimney sweeping services. It’s common to inquire about the scope of cleaning, the tools used, and whether any repairs or further inspections are recommended afterward. Proper maintenance can extend the lifespan of the chimney system and help ensure safe operation, making professional sweeping a valuable step for those looking to keep their home’s fireplace or stove functioning properly.

Chimney Sweeping Questions
How often should a chimney be swept? It is recommended to have the chimney inspected and cleaned at least once a year to ensure safe and efficient operation.
What signs indicate a chimney needs cleaning? Visible soot buildup, odors, smoke backdrafts, or a slow-burning fire are common signs that cleaning may be needed.
What types of fireplaces benefit from chimney sweeping? Both wood-burning and gas fireplaces can benefit from regular chimney cleaning to prevent buildup and ensure proper venting.
What is the purpose of chimney sweeping? The main goal is to remove creosote, soot, and debris to reduce fire risk and improve the fireplace’s performance.
